The Importance of Choosing Safe and Comfortable Clothing
When dressing your baby for the holidays, comfort and safety should be top priorities. Opt for soft, breathable fabrics like cotton to prevent skin irritation. Avoid clothes with small buttons or decorations that could be choking hazards. Make sure outfits aren't too tight or restrictive. This is especially important for growing babies. Look for clothes with easy diaper access to make changes quick and simple. Consider the temperature when choosing outfits. Layers are often a good choice for adjusting to different environments. Avoid clothes with drawstrings or long ties that could pose a strangulation risk. Always check for any loose threads or rough seams that might bother your baby's sensitive skin.

Combining Fashion with Practicality: Dressing Your Little One
Dressing your baby for the holidays doesn't have to mean sacrificing practicality. Look for outfits that are easy to put on and take off. Snap closures or zippers can make diaper changes much easier. Choose fabrics that are machine washable to handle inevitable spills and messes. Consider buying clothes a size up to accommodate growth spurts. This also allows for layering in colder weather. Opt for versatile pieces that can be mixed and matched. A festive cardigan can dress up a simple onesie for different occasions. For crawling babies, reinforced knees on pants can prevent wear and tear. Don't forget about comfort during naps. Soft, loose-fitting clothes are best for sleep time.

Decorating Your Home for a Baby-Friendly Holiday Season
Creating a festive environment for babies requires a balance of holiday cheer and safety. Opt for unbreakable ornaments on lower tree branches. Use baby gates to block off areas with delicate decorations. Soft, plush holiday characters make great, safe decorations for the nursery. Avoid using small decorations that could be choking hazards. Instead of lit candles, try battery-operated flameless versions for a cozy glow. Hang stockings and wreaths out of baby's reach. Use wall decals for festive touches that won't pose any danger. Create a cozy reading nook with holiday-themed board books. Remember to secure any electrical cords from lights or decorations. With some creativity, you can make your home both festive and baby-friendly.
